Conflict is a fact of life. Every important relationship experiences it. Conflict can be destructive or it can be healthy. Paul addresses an open conflict in this church and gives us insight as to how the gospel can move conflict to a healthy outcome. Outline: I Cor. 1:10-12; 3 John 9,10; Titus 3:9-11; and James 4:1-2 I. Paul appeals to them for unity II. Paul addresses them as individuals v.1 III. Paul appeals to them to agree in the Lord v.2 IV. Paul appeals to the Church v.3
